Casey Brienza, sociologist specializing in the study of the culture industries and transnational cultural production, argues that UK researchers represent too small a proportion of global scholarly knowledge production and consumption to rebalance scholarly expenditure. She considers that UK open access initiatives as currently formulated will instead lead to a significant de facto increase in costs for the UK.
